It's weird how doctors are so different in their approach with the lapband. My surgeon only had me on Clear Liquids for 1 day before the surgery, and 2 days after the surgery. Then I get to start on mushies for 2 weeks, advancing to regular food slowly thereafter....So far I've felt no restriction with the liquids. Although I don't guzzle, it feels like I could and I'd be ok....I hope I really DO have restriction! However I don't feel all that hungry either....

So far I haven't had to take any pain meds besides the children's tylenol....I may take some Lortab before I go to bed to ensure a full night sleep though!
